Answer:

x = 75

Step-by-step explanation:

Given information from the question:

x - 3y = 30

y = 15

We can substitute y = 15 into the equation to find x.

x - 3(15) = 30

x - 45 = 30

x - 45 + 45 = 30 + 45

x = 75
